As per Robot Institute of America robot is “A programmable, multifunction manipulator designed to move material, parts, tools or specific devices through variable programmed motions for the performance of a variety of tasks”. Manufacturing and AI, currently appear to be merging. Manufacturing is now shifting to a “mass customization” phase, where companies that can economically make short runs of special order goods are thriving. Example self-driving car to take you to work or to an appointment, drive home and park for free and then return later to pick you up.
The pressure is on for industrial robots, more correctly referred to as industrial manipulators, to be rapidly reprogrammed and more forgiving if a part isn’t placed exactly as expected in its workspace. As a result, AI techniques are migrating to industrial manipulators.
